A heavy, display-oriented serif with broad proportions and strongly bracketed, flared stroke endings that give the letterforms a carved, sculptural feel. Strokes are robust with moderate contrast, and terminals often swell into wedge-like serifs rather than crisp slabs, producing a soft-edged but powerful silhouette. Counters are compact yet open enough to stay readable at larger sizes, and the rhythm is steady with slightly lively curves and subtle tapering where stems meet serifs. Lowercase forms are weighty with rounded shoulders and occasional ball-like terminals, while the numerals match the same chunky, grounded construction.

This face works best for high-impact applications such as headlines, poster typography, mastheads, and brand marks where a bold serif voice is needed. It also suits packaging and label-style graphics that benefit from a vintage or institutional tone, especially when set at medium-to-large sizes.

The overall tone is bold and declarative, with a nostalgic, print-forward character that suggests traditional signage and classic editorial display. It feels confident and institutional, lending a slightly collegiate or heritage flavor without becoming overly formal.

The design appears intended to deliver maximum presence with a traditional serif framework, using flared, bracketed endings and compact interior space to create a strong, memorable texture. It aims to balance classic familiarity with a slightly sculpted, display-centric personality.

In the text sample, the dense weight and stout serifs create strong word shapes and high impact, best suited to headlines rather than long passages. The flaring at stroke ends adds warmth and motion compared to a purely geometric or slabby build, and the joins show a subtly organic, ink-friendly shaping.
